The Role of Nanotechnology in Car Coatings for Scratch Resistance

Nanotechnology has revolutionized the world of car coatings by introducing advanced materials and techniques that enhance durability and performance. By using nanoparticles, these coatings can achieve superior scratch resistance and protection compared to traditional coatings. The ability of nanotechnology to manipulate materials at the molecular level allows for the development of coatings that are not only incredibly thin but also incredibly tough. This results in a longer-lasting finish that can withstand the everyday wear and tear that vehicles experience.

Understanding Scratch Resistance in Car Coatings

Scratch resistance in car coatings is a vital aspect that directly impacts the longevity and appearance of a vehicle’s exterior. With advancements in nanotechnology, car manufacturers and detailing experts are able to offer coatings that provide enhanced protection against scratches, swirl marks, and other minor damages. These innovative coatings contain microscopic ceramic particles that create a strong and durable barrier on the surface of the car, effectively shielding it from everyday wear and tear.

In addition to enhancing scratch resistance, these modern coatings also offer improved chemical resistance, UV protection, and water repellency. This means that not only are scratches minimized, but the overall appearance of the car is preserved for a longer period of time. What is nanotechnology and how does it impact car coatings?

Nanotechnology is the manipulation of materials at a very small scale, typically at the nanometer level. When applied to car coatings, nanotechnology helps create a protective layer that is more durable and resistant to scratches.

Can scratch-resistant coatings prevent all types of scratches?

While scratch-resistant coatings can provide protection against minor scratches, they may not be able to prevent all types of scratches, especially those caused by sharp or heavy objects. It is still important to practice caution when handling your car to avoid potential damage.
